HD 500 blank screen

Hello everyone...

 

I just got my second Pod HD 500 pedal (first one only pulsed - on and off for the screen),

 

This second one worked right out of the box. Then I did the install Monkey and updated all of the drivers and such. It seemed to work after the updates.

 

I then went into utilites and got to Variax and then the screen froze. I unpluged, repluged and then all I got was a blank screen.

 

The foot switches light up and if I turn the select knob they do change - but you can't see a thing on the screen.

 

I reloaded the updates and drivers, but unfortunetly no change.

 

Any ideas before I submit to Tech Support?

    Re: HD 500 blank screen

    Hi,

     

    It could be a bad flash install... Try this:

     

    Hold down the DOWN arrow on the D-Pad while powering the 500 up.

     

    The LCD will read UPDATE FLASH.

     

    Connect it to your computer and reflash the 500.

     

    Also, it could be under powered. Are you using the original power supply?
